Oracle 20c 新特性:SQL 宏支援(SQL Macro)Scalar 和 Table 模式

  • 2019 年 10 月 6 日
  • 筆記

SQL宏特性,允許開發人員將複雜的處理通過宏定義實現,隨後可以在 SQL 中任何位置調用宏。這個特性的實現類似於12c中實現的 Function in SQL 特性。

在 Oracle Database 20c 中,Oracle 帶來了 SQL 的超級增強 – SQL 宏 (SQL Macro)特性。

SQL宏特性,允許開發人員將複雜的處理通過宏定義實現,隨後可以在 SQL 中任何位置調用宏。這個特性的實現類似於12c中實現的 Function in SQL 特性。

SQL宏支援兩種類型:

  • 標量 – Scalar;
  • 表 – Table;

標量表達式,可以用在 SELECT列表,WHERE / HAVING ,Group BY / Order By 等語句中;

表方式可以用於 FROM 語句中。

Oracle 20c 的SQL 能力正在極大的增強。

出自:墨天輪資訊(https://www.modb.pro/db/6640,點擊「閱讀原文」或者複製到瀏覽器直接打開)

數據和雲

ID:OraNews

文章詳情:數據和雲(OraNews)